Abstract

The utility model discloses a shell with a function of radiating a power module of GPS signal receiving and transmitting equipment, which comprises a fin type radiator plate, wherein the fin type radiator plate is directly used as a rear cover of the shell and is fixedly connected with a closed surrounding frame of the shell, the fin type radiator plate is directly connected with a high-power module in the shell as the radiator plate of the receiving and transmitting equipment power module, the end face of the front cover and the end face of the rear cover of the surrounding frame are respectively provided with an annular groove, when the front cover and the rear cover of the shell are connected with the surrounding frame, the front cover and the rear cover of the shell are sealed through O-shaped rings arranged in the annular grooves, and an antistatic coating layer is sprayed on the outer surfaces of the fin type radiator plate and the surrounding frame. According to the utility model, the fin type radiator plate is directly used as the rear cover of the shell, so that the heat dissipation of the power module is ensured, and the power module is prevented from being damaged by interference due to the fact that the anti-static coating is coated.

Description

Shell capable of radiating power module of GPS signal receiving and transmitting equipment
Technical Field
The utility model relates to a shell for radiating a power module of GPS signal receiving and transmitting equipment.
Background
The signal receiving and transmitting equipment is field operation stock equipment, and is convenient to carry, and miniaturization design is usually carried out, so that the signal processing module of the equipment is a high-heating device because of carrying a massive data processing and transmission task, a fan is usually arranged on a shell for heat dissipation, and dust can be brought into the shell by the fan which is arranged in the severe environment of field operation to damage a running circuit board.
Disclosure of Invention
The utility model provides a shell for radiating a power module of GPS signal receiving and transmitting equipment, which directly uses a fin type radiator plate as a rear cover of the shell, directly fixes the power module on the rear cover, removes a fan and ensures the radiation of the power module, and simultaneously, the fin type radiator plate comprises the rest part of the shell and is coated with an antistatic coating so as to ensure that the power module cannot be damaged by interference.
In order to achieve the above purpose, the technical scheme provided by the utility model is as follows:
a housing having heat dissipation for a power module of a GPS signal transceiver device, comprising a finned radiator plate, wherein: the fin type radiator plate is directly used as a rear cover of the shell and is connected and fixed with a closed surrounding frame of the shell, the fin type radiator plate is directly connected with a power module of receiving and transmitting equipment in the shell in a pasting mode, annular grooves are respectively formed in the end face of the front cover and the end face of the rear cover of the surrounding frame, when the front cover and the rear cover of the shell are connected with the surrounding frame, O-shaped rings arranged in the annular grooves are sealed, and an antistatic coating layer is sprayed on the outer surfaces of the fin type radiator plate and the surrounding frame.
The scheme is further as follows: the thickness of the antistatic coating layer is greater than 0.1mm.
The scheme is further as follows: the fins of the radiator plate are straight fins, and the height of the fins is at least 30mm.
The scheme is further as follows: and a film control panel is stuck on the upper surface of the front cover and is connected with a control circuit board in the shell through a connecting flat cable by a strip hole arranged on the front cover.
The scheme is further as follows: grooves are formed in two side faces of the surrounding frame and are used for being connected with equipment handles.
The utility model has the advantages that: through the back lid that directly regard as the casing with fin formula radiator board, with power module direct fixation behind cover, guaranteed power module's heat dissipation when removing the fan, including the coating of casing other parts on fin formula radiator board simultaneously and prevent static coating, can not produce static when human touching the casing, guaranteed power module can not be disturbed the damage.

Detailed Description
A housing for radiating heat from a power module of a GPS signal transceiver device, as shown in fig. 1 and 2, the housing comprising a fin-type radiator plate 1, which is an alloy aluminum radiator plate, wherein: the fin type radiator plate 1 is directly used as a rear cover of the shell and is connected and fixed with a closed surrounding frame 2 of the shell, the fin type radiator plate 1 is used as a radiator plate of a receiving and transmitting device power module 3 and is directly connected with the power module in the shell in a pasting mode, the fin type radiator plate is bonded through heat conduction insulating glue or is filled with a heat conduction insulating pad, then a control circuit board 4 for installing the power module 3 is connected with the radiator plate 1 through bolts, the circuit board 4 compacts the power module 3 on the radiator plate 1, the front cover end face and the rear cover end face of the surrounding frame 2 are respectively provided with an annular groove 201, the annular grooves 201 are used for placing sealing O-shaped rings, when the front cover 5 of the shell is connected with the surrounding frame as the rear cover of the fin type radiator plate, the O-shaped rings are arranged in the annular grooves 201 in a sealing mode, anti-static paint layers are sprayed on the outer surfaces of the fin type radiator plate 1 and the surrounding frame 2, the thickness of the anti-static paint layers is larger than 0.1mm, and the sprayed thickness can be calculated through the using amount and area.
In an embodiment, to ensure a heat dissipation effect: the fins 101 of the radiator plate are at least 30mm in height and are straight fins for ventilation and heat dissipation.
In the examples: the upper surface of the front cover 5 is stuck with a film control panel 6, the connection flat cable of the film control panel 6 is connected with the control circuit board 4 in the shell through a strip hole 501 arranged on the front cover, a rectangular opening 502 of an LCD screen is arranged on the front cover, and the front cover 5 is connected with the surrounding frame 2 through screws.
Wherein: grooves 202 are formed in two side faces of the surrounding frame 2, the grooves 202 are used for connecting equipment handles, and antenna connecting seat holes 203 are formed in the top side face of the surrounding frame 2.
According to the embodiment of the shell for radiating the power module of the GPS signal receiving and transmitting device, the fin type radiator plate is directly used as the rear cover of the shell, the power module is directly fixed on the rear cover, the fan is removed, meanwhile, the heat radiation of the power module is guaranteed, meanwhile, the fin type radiator plate comprises the rest part of the shell, an antistatic coating is coated on the rest part of the shell, static electricity is not generated when a human body touches the shell, and the power module is guaranteed not to be damaged by interference.
